A rough engine idle condition may occur when the vehicle's battery is disconnected for less than 30 minutes on some 2001 and later Subaru vehicles, up to and including the 2003 Legacy and Baja. Here are some common reasons for such a problem: Dirty or Faulty Idle Air Control Valve (IACV): The IACV regulates the amount of air that bypasses the throttle plate and enters the engine during idle.
